Inter coach Antonio Conte thinks the Nerazzurri squad are suffering from poor personality, mental strength and therefore aren’t used to winning, according to a report from today’s paper edition of the Milano based newspaper Gazzetta dello Sport.
The report details how the 50-year-old Italian coach is incredibly disappointed in the squad since the restart of the season, after the Coronavirus stop. The club restarted their campaign with a Coppa Italia semi-final loss to Napoli, and have only won three of their last six league games since.
The Suning group, owners of Inter, share his thoughts, the report continues, and also want to win, believing in the former Italy and Chelsea coach, despite rumours that Conte may leave at the end of the season.
The 50-year-old Italian coach believes that the squad have little personality and aren’t used to winning, so struggle to close out games and drop points after making small mistakes.
